problems 7 - 9: given the first term and rule:
circle if it is an arithmetic sequence, geometric sequence or neither
write the first 4 terms of each sequence.

  1. first term 1

rule multiply the previous term by 1

  1. first term 1

rule add 1 to the previous number and square it

  1. first term 12

rule add 4 to the previous number
arithmetic sequence
geometric sequence
neither

Explanation:

Step1: Analyze problem 7

First - term \(a_1 = 1\), rule \(a_{n}=a_{n - 1}\times1\). First 4 terms: \(1,1,1,1\). It's geometric (common - ratio 1).

Step2: Analyze problem 8

First - term \(a_1 = 1\), rule \(a_{n}=(a_{n - 1}+1)^2\). Terms: \(1,4,25,676\). Neither.

Step3: Analyze problem 9

First - term \(a_1 = 12\), rule \(a_{n}=a_{n - 1}+4\). Terms: \(12,16,20,24\). Arithmetic.

Answer:

  1. Geometric Sequence, 1, 1, 1, 1
  2. Neither, 1, 4, 25, 676
  3. Arithmetic Sequence, 12, 16, 20, 24
